Scrum is an agile framework based on observation, experience, and continuous improvement. A Scrum Master acts as a coach and servant leader who ensures Scrum principles are followed for project success.
With rising demand across industries, many professionals choose Scrum Master training to gain practical skills, remove roadblocks, and lead teams with confidence.

India has seen a significant rise in non-IT professionals transitioning into Scrum careers because the role focuses more on leadership, communication, collaboration, and process management than on technical programming skills. Professionals from diverse backgrounds such as banking, healthcare, marketing, HR, and operations are finding Scrum to be an excellent career option, as it allows them to apply their problem-solving and team management abilities in agile work environments. With organizations increasingly adopting agile methodologies, the demand for skilled Scrum professionals continues to grow across multiple industries.

Scrum is an Agile framework used by teams to manage projects, collaborate effectively, and deliver products in small, manageable steps called sprints.
A Scrum Master helps the team follow Scrum practices, facilitates meetings, removes obstacles, and supports continuous improvement.

A Sprint is a fixed period, usually 1–4 weeks, during which the team works to complete specific tasks and deliver value.
<p data-start="1539" data-end="1564">Scrum ceremonies include:</p><ul data-start="1565" data-end="1635"><li data-section-id="18pe8rb" data-start="1565" data-end="1582">Sprint Planning</li><li data-section-id="8baxnv" data-start="1583" data-end="1596">Daily Scrum</li><li data-section-id="10xnids" data-start="1597" data-end="1612">Sprint Review</li><li data-section-id="1nbpbpb" data-start="1613" data-end="1635">Sprint Retrospective</li></ul><h4 data-start="1637" data-end="1705"> </h4>
